Mesut Ozil has spoken about his successful year, saying that he has looked after “the small details”, such as having more sleep and more physiotherapy.
Ozil has been having the best season of his career.
“The biggest change started when I was injured last year and I changed my diet and started to look at the small details in my life,” Ozil said. “For example I started to have physiotherapy on my days off and made sure I had a good sleep. That is crucial over here [in England]. It is the fastest league in the world and we often play twice a week with no winter break.
“I also missed football a lot when I was injured and I don’t want that to happen again,” Özil added. “That’s why I am doing everything I can to avoid it now. It is also the case that when you are playing well you get more confident. The team is more mature and more consistent this season and I get a lot of help on the pitch. It is only because of their help I can do my best.”
